Understanding the Basics: Essential Skills for Success
Before diving into the nitty-gritty of automating lock activity logging, it’s crucial to understand the foundational skills that form the backbone of this field. These skills are not only technical but also involve a deep understanding of security protocols and compliance standards.
1. Knowledge of Security Protocols: Understanding various security protocols like OAuth, OpenID Connect, and Kerberos is essential. These protocols help in securing lock activities by ensuring that only authorized users can access restricted areas.
2. Familiarity with Database Management: Lock activity logging often involves storing and managing large volumes of data. Therefore, knowledge of database management systems (DBMS) like MySQL, PostgreSQL, or NoSQL databases (MongoDB) is crucial.
3. Programming Skills: Proficiency in programming languages such as Python, Java, or C# is indispensable. These languages are commonly used for developing scripts and applications that automate lock activity logging.
4. Understanding Compliance Standards: Compliance with standards like GDPR, HIPAA, or ISO 27001 is non-negotiable. Knowing these standards ensures that your logging practices meet regulatory requirements.
Best Practices for Implementing Automated Lock Activity Logging
Once you have the necessary skills, the next step is to implement these best practices to ensure that your lock activity logging system is efficient and secure.
1. Regular Audits and Monitoring: Continuous monitoring of lock activity logs is crucial. Regular audits can help identify anomalies and potential security breaches early.
2. Data Anonymization: Protecting user privacy is paramount. Implement data anonymization techniques to ensure that sensitive information is not exposed in the logs.
3. Scalability and Performance: As your organization grows, the lock activity logging system should be scalable to handle increased data volumes without compromising performance.
4. Integration with Existing Systems: Ensure that the lock activity logging system integrates seamlessly with existing security tools and processes. This integration helps in maintaining a cohesive security framework.
